Imperva Incapsula

Security

Imperva Incapsula is a cloud-based security and performance service that provides a web application firewall (WAF), DDoS mitigation, a global CDN, and bot mitigation to protect websites and applications from threats and improve their speed.

1,693 detections
1690 sites

Kasada

Security

Kasada is a cybersecurity company that provides a platform to protect websites and web applications from bot attacks and malicious activities.

Imperva Incapsula vs Kasada: In-Depth Analysis

Imperva Incapsula and Kasada represent two distinct approaches within the security category, characterized by vastly different market footprints according to StackOptic data. While Imperva Incapsula maintains a detection count of 305 across 304 unique sites, Kasada currently shows a detection count of 0 in this specific dataset. This disparity highlights Imperva Incapsula as an established player with a diverse portfolio of high-traffic users including 2checkout.com, aarp.org, and accor.com. In contrast, Kasada positions itself as a focused cybersecurity platform dedicated to protecting web applications from bot attacks and malicious activities. The comparison between these two services hinges on the breadth of features versus specialized protection. Imperva Incapsula provides an integrated suite including a web application firewall (WAF), DDoS mitigation, and a global CDN, whereas Kasada centers its value proposition on the mitigation of automated threats. Understanding these architectural differences is essential for engineering teams deciding between a multi-functional performance and security layer and a targeted bot defense solution.
